Skip to main content
Image coming soon

Strategic Sourcing 341-2651 Dell 50Pk Lto3 400800Gb Tape Media

STRATEGIC SOURCING

$1,298.46
Write a Review
SKU:
341-2651
Condition:
New
Shipping:
Free Shipping
Adding to cart… The item has been added